Siasia set to unveil Dream Team VI squad for Korea Invitational

By Daily Sports on May 27, 2016

 Coach of the U-23 national team, Samson Siasia is expected to release the list of players for next month’s Suwon Invitational Tournament in South Korea today.

It was a full house yesterday with the arrival of the foreign-based players to the Dream Team VI camp.

Those who beat the Wednesday arrival deadline set by coach Siasia include team captain Azubuike Okechukwu, Stanley Amuzie ,Godwin Saviour, Taiwo Awoniyi and Usman Mohammed.

Also in camp is England- based Nathan Oduwa. With the arrival of the six players, the camp now has seven of the eight foreign based players invited to camp, with France based midfielder Sodiq Popoola expected in camp on Friday (today) due to flight challenges.

Speaking yesterday, Captain Okechukwu expressed delight in being called upon to wear the colors of the country as he sees it as a thing of pride and honor.

“This is a big family and any time I am called upon to be part of the family, I feel highly honored and as such will do everything to make it. I have had a hectic season and as such had wanted to rest a little with my family, but this is a call to duty which I must honor, so I had to cut short my rest to beat the deadline set by my coach who I know is a no –nonsense person.”

“The team is schedule is to fly out from Abuja on Monday all things being equal,” a team official said. (The AUTHORITY)
